How to care for Begonia Angelique
- Maintain evenly moist soil, but avoid over-watering, as this can lead to rot.
- Provide partial shade or dappled sunlight, as intense direct sunlight may scorch the leaves.
- Apply a balanced liquid fertilizer monthly during the growing season to support healthy growth.
- Prune spent blooms and yellowing leaves to encourage new growth and maintain a tidy appearance.
- In regions with harsh winters, dig up the bulbs after the foliage has died back and store them in a cool, dry place until spring planting.

How to care for Fragrant Red Glory
- Simply find a spot with well-drained soil and partial shade.
- Dig a hole slightly larger than the root ball and plant the begonia 1-2 inches deep.
- Water well and add a layer of mulch to keep the soil moist.
- Fertilize with a balanced fertilizer every 4-6 weeks.
- Deadhead spent blooms to encourage new growth and pinch back leggy stems to promote bushier growth.
